"The Key To My Secrets"

This is the name of the recital dance that I choreographed for my modern class at Cecil Dancenter. It's to the song "Secrets" by One Republic, so you can probably see a theme here. We use a large golden key as a prop to represent the secrets that each and every one of us holds onto in our lives. At the end of the dance the key is given away so there is nothing left to hide. We have less than a minute of the dance left to finish, which is spectacular considering there is still about two and a half months until the recital.

I am so proud of my students and I'm very pleased with everything we have accomplished so far this year. They all work hard in class, they're always on their best behavior, and they are talented dancers. As a teacher, I couldn't ask for more :)

This past Saturday I held a "photoshoot" during our class time since the recital costumes came in the week before. I absolutely adore  their costumes, by the way. They look even better in person than they did in the picture! It is a light, flowy top with shorts and it is iridescent with a hint of gold to match the key.
